NAVSEA warfare centers strategic plan calls for technological modernization

By Aidan Quigley / May 11, 2021 at 11:30 AM

Naval Sea Systems Command's Warfare Centers will work to leverage emerging technology and modernize their infrastructure, the centers' new strategic plan states.

The Navy released the centers' 2021-2025 strategic plan Monday. The plan lists five strategic goals: "workforce and leadership development; mission-aligned strategies at the division level; technical innovation and excellence; business excellence and improvement; and right culture/values."

The Warfare Centers perform research, development, test and evaluation assessment activity for surface/undersea systems and subsystems, the plan states.

The plan calls for infrastructure improvements, and for the centers to develop capabilities in emerging technology areas for the Navy's future.

"The NAVSEA Warfare Centers will provide unique value to the Navy and the nation through innovation, collaboration, and delivering superior capability before or as soon as it is needed," the plan states.

Centers should recruit and retain the best personnel and provide them with leadership opportunities, according to the plan. It calls for the centers to remove barriers and encourage a diversity of thought.

The centers will also strive to improve their business processes, improve communication and improve diversity and inclusion, the plan said.
